javaweb
文章平均质量分 96
主要记录写web时遇到的一些问题。
ystraw_ah
人生最有价值的时刻,不是最后的功成名就,而是对未来正充满期待与不安。
展开
-
65-前端利用js实现页面左右滑动切换页面
主要利用js的鼠标按键按下和抬起两个监听函数即可实现,请看下面的例子。<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title></title> <style type="text/css"> #test{width: 300;...原创 2019-11-02 18:54:30 · 4119 阅读 · 1 评论 -
15-js提交表单的简单检测实例
<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%><!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"&...原创 2018-12-24 18:50:00 · 122 阅读 · 0 评论 -
16-图片上传那些事 org.springframework.web.multipart.MultipartException: The current request is not a multip
https://blog.csdn.net/u010974598/article/details/46458039我曾尝试了:@RequestMapping(value="/user/register") public ModelAndView toRegister( Integer flag, User user, MultipartHttpSe...原创 2018-12-29 16:16:00 · 286 阅读 · 0 评论 -
17-js 提交表单以及判空
js原创 2018-12-30 09:55:00 · 83 阅读 · 0 评论 -
18-javaweb-ssm 开发中错误总结
由于web课设于是,写了几天的javaweb,在写的过程中总会遇到奇奇怪怪的一些bug, 一般都得花很多时间解决。但是解决多了,后面碰到类似的简单多了。总结下:一.前端错误:1.js错误,看前端控制台报错,慢慢调,有可能是没导入包,或者参数类型,标签名不一致错误;2.form表单的名字和后台类的名字不一致;二、后台错误:1.实体类有没有无参构造方法;2.映...原创 2018-12-31 20:39:00 · 68 阅读 · 0 评论 -
19-Javaweb项目读取本地图片通过虚拟路径
有时会把文件存在本地如将图片等放在c、d盘等,在javaweb引用时会出现无法直接访问的问题,但是还是有办法解决的。可以通过配置虚拟路径:步骤一:双击servers下面的tomcat, 在弹出的窗口下面选择 Modules 进行如下配置:上面框里填你本地路径,下面框里填写你的虚拟路径,例如:D:\ dataResourceImages在使用时,就...原创 2019-01-01 13:46:00 · 274 阅读 · 0 评论 -
20-java 对象链表空没空呢
写了一个 对象链表,往里面add了一些对象,最后我想看下链表是否为空,用 == null 为假,也看不出, 看下长度? 好吧, size() = 1;打印 null , 那到底是不是空 啊, 仔细想下,链表里面应该不空,size( ) = 1 嘛,不要怀疑编译器呀, 那打印出来为空,说明里面的对象为 Null;这就跟集合一样, 包含空集的集合不为空啊啊啊啊, 能理解这个就好办了,...原创 2019-01-01 19:55:00 · 254 阅读 · 0 评论 -
21-js 实现评论时间格式转化
js里面要用可以用伊尔表达式,循环是用js:<span style="color:#ff0000">document.getElementById("${pj.pltime }").innerHTML = dateToGMT("${pj.pltime }");</span> <div class="order-info"> ...原创 2019-01-01 20:15:00 · 158 阅读 · 0 评论 -
22-maven-安装与配置
转载:https://blog.csdn.net/wy727764020/article/details/80595451Maven的安装以及eclipse中配置maven2018年06月06日 15:15:14这个我知道阅读数:2935Maven的安装以及eclipse中配置maven1、 到官网找到这个,点击直接下载(官网地址:http://maven.apa...原创 2019-01-07 12:17:00 · 90 阅读 · 0 评论 -
23-新建maven 项目
1. 新建:Maven Project;2. 配置项 bulid path, 添加tomcat;3. 新建一个sources文件夹: srt/test/resourses4.配置她的默认输出路径:将test/java下面的复制到、test/resourse的Output folder里面,之后如下图:5. 可以运行了!...原创 2019-01-07 12:56:00 · 63 阅读 · 0 评论 -
24-filter-拦截器
在web.xml里面配置,有两种形式:然后编写filter类: @Override public void doFilter(ServletRequest arg0, ServletResponse arg1, FilterChain arg2) throws IOException, ServletException { HttpServletRe...原创 2019-01-07 18:51:00 · 75 阅读 · 0 评论 -
4-js 函数
总是有些奇奇怪怪的问题:<div> <p class="productStatus"> <span>成交量 <em>${goods.volume }</em></span> <span> <a href="javascript:void(...原创 2019-01-07 21:09:00 · 69 阅读 · 0 评论 -
5-去掉a标签下划线,禁止a标签的跳转
1.去下划线: 写样式,a{text-decoration:none; 或在a标签内联里面写style="text-decoration:none;";2.禁用a标签跳转:a标签href不跳转 禁止跳转当页面中a标签不需要任何跳转时,从原理上来讲,可分如下两种方法: 标签属性href,使其指向空或不返回任何内容。如: <a href="javas...原创 2019-01-09 17:56:00 · 449 阅读 · 0 评论 -
26- java的String 转json
https://www.cnblogs.com/nihaorz/p/5885307.htmlGjson 下载:https://download.csdn.net/download/qq_39451578/10908642import com.google.gson.JsonObject;import com.google.gson.JsonParser;public clas...原创 2019-01-10 14:33:00 · 124 阅读 · 0 评论 -
27-java String 之间比较的幺蛾子
仔细看啊, 他有双引号啊!!!!原创 2019-01-10 16:08:00 · 65 阅读 · 0 评论 -
14- Servlet.service() for servlet [mvc-dispatcher] in context with path [/collegeservice] threw exc
有的service没有依赖注入:原创 2018-12-24 17:23:00 · 276 阅读 · 0 评论 -
13-前端不通路径同一个请求访问同一个页面时,有时样式没有加载出来(jss,image,css)...
通过如下方式访问同一个网站时,下面一个可以加载样式,而下面一个加载的页面却没有样式,思考良久没有想通,当时也忘记了用浏览器看下css,js,image的请求路径,其实在前端页面里面我直接:这样引用资源的,是由于路径问题,改为一下就可以了,pwd是自己配置的相对路径:...原创 2018-12-23 21:54:00 · 117 阅读 · 0 评论 -
12-ssm中的description The request sent by the client was syntactically incorrect.
此问题一般是在前端的数据传回是封装成对象失败的情况:1.对象名不一致;2.对象的数据类型不一致;特别注意日期类型的:如果前端是date数据类型的话:传入的日期有问题在pojo类中限定@DateTimeFormat(pattern = "yyyy-MM-dd")private Date inventoryTime;...原创 2018-12-20 19:48:00 · 80 阅读 · 1 评论 -
62- Java解析json数组三种情况
转载自:https://blog.csdn.net/luo_Json/article/details/89644680import com.alibaba.fastjson.JSON;import com.alibaba.fastjson.JSONArray;public class Main { /** * * @param args */...转载 2019-09-13 12:00:52 · 482 阅读 · 0 评论 -
44-删除table的一行
目的:删除表格中被点击的一行。<!DOCTYPE html><html> <head> <meta charset="UTF-8"> <title></title> <script> function delword(id, ob...原创 2019-08-21 23:56:32 · 282 阅读 · 0 评论 -
62-js-表单验证及多选框
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"><html> <head> <base href="<%=basePath%>"> <title>Lesson1</title> <meta...原创 2019-08-15 20:50:17 · 281 阅读 · 0 评论 -
31-java中知识总结:list, set, map, stack, queue
import java.util.ArrayList;import java.util.HashMap;import java.util.HashSet;import java.util.LinkedList;import java.util.List;import java.util.Queue;import java.util.Scanner;import java.util....原创 2019-02-24 20:05:00 · 76 阅读 · 0 评论 -
12-在eclipse上安装lxml
1.可用easy_install安装方式,也可以用pip的方式: pip install lxml2.安装完毕:写代码导包时提示错误,这是需要配置一下eclipse,是因为它没有更新导入的包,所以需要将原来的删了, 重新导入:...原创 2018-07-15 10:47:00 · 83 阅读 · 0 评论 -
4-在windon10上mysql安装与图形化管理
安装及可能遇到的问题: 1.windows10上安装mysql(详细步骤 https://blog.csdn.net/zhouzezhou/article/details/52446608 2.在启动MYSQL时出现问题:“ERROR 2003 (HY000): Can't connect to MySQL server on ...原创 2018-10-16 12:47:00 · 129 阅读 · 0 评论 -
63-Alert 自动消失-重写弹窗
最近需要用到弹窗,并且,需要弹出后2秒自动消失,于是查了一波,发现alert没有这个功能,需要自己写。所以我去网上掏了一个代码,并修改为自己需要的了。演示如下:代码如下:<html><head> <title>JavaScript自动关闭窗口</title> <meta http-equiv="content-Type"...原创 2019-08-20 15:11:10 · 2277 阅读 · 0 评论 -
70-webApp打包:将网站利用hbuilder打包为安卓app
感觉现在开发网页比写安卓应用简单多了,至少对我是这样,我安卓跟没学一样,于是在某次需求中需要写个简单的APP,我就想能不能弄成网页的,网页做出手机版,用手机访问不就是app了吗?于是去网上找了下资源,发现Hbuilder 还真可以这样做,它自动可以生成一套关于App的配置文件,你改了url让他默认访问到你网站的主页即可,一切如此美好。本文提纲:介绍实用Hbuilder打包成安...原创 2019-08-05 17:08:01 · 1386 阅读 · 1 评论 -
69-记单词软件及网站开发(一)
本人英语渣渣,曾今因为英语死过很多次,现在依然是!!!但是也想学好英语,学好英语得记单词呀。于是引出了记单词的需求,市场上这么多单词软件还不够你用吗?非得作死自己搞一个,用室友的话说:这是对技术的追求!狗屁,哪那么闲啊,主要是别人的软件用着总会感觉有不合适的地方,所以如果按照自己的需求设计一款记单词软件和网站,你就别找借口不想记单词是因为别人的软件要收钱或者不好用!!! ...原创 2020-02-03 20:54:50 · 5713 阅读 · 6 评论 -
5- 如何把MyEclipse中的web项目导入到Eclipse中运行
from:如何把MyEclipse中的web项目导入到Eclipse中运行2016年09月12日 20:57:51dancheren阅读数:35329标签:eclipse更多个人分类:编程工具https://blog.csdn.net/dancheren/article/details/52517184有时我们需要将MyEclipse中的项目导入到Eclips...原创 2018-10-18 17:11:00 · 116 阅读 · 0 评论 -
10-Linux与windows文件互传-pscp坑---- pscp 不是内部或外部命令,也不是可运行的程序或批处理文件...
1.下载pscp工具http://www.chiark.greenend.org.uk/~sgtatham/putty/download.html2.拷贝到C:\Windows\System32如果考到其他文件夹,运行提示 'pscp' 不是内部或外部命令,也不是可运行的程序或批处理文件。 那么考到这个文件下吧!!!3.配置环境变量(可以先省掉,一般不需要这步,直接第四步即可)...原创 2018-10-19 20:08:00 · 2189 阅读 · 2 评论 -
6-Linux 上mysql的常用命令 以及 tomcat的相关指定
mysql -u root -p 进入Mysql//注意一下有逗号!!!show databases; //显示所有的数据库drop database mydb; // 删除mydb这个数据库create database ysblog; //创建一个ysblog数据库use ysblog; //进入ysblog数据库source /usr/local/my_da...原创 2018-10-22 19:25:00 · 77 阅读 · 0 评论 -
7-云服务器配置及将本地的javaweb项目部署到Linux服务器的详细操作
目录一、基本流程介绍:二、对于从windows和Linux互传文件的方法感觉还是用:pscp比较简单三、详细步骤:1.在服务器端安装jdk:2.安装tomcat:3.安装Mysql数据库(以下摘抄自mir_soh):4.部署项目:至此,已经可以访问你的项目了!!!参考博客:一、基本流程介绍:1.安装jdk;2.安装tomcat;3.安装m...原创 2018-10-22 19:41:00 · 288 阅读 · 0 评论 -
11-简单解释spingmvc项目的结构
可以简单的理解为下面这样子:原创 2018-12-11 18:42:00 · 67 阅读 · 0 评论 -
28- foreach里面实现一次遍历两个链表
由于业务需求,要在一个foreach里面实现一次遍历两个链表:后台传来的是连个list: 分别是 <c:set var = "i" value = "0"/> <c:forEach items="${requestScope.sppurchases}" var="spp" varStatus="stat"> <...原创 2019-01-10 18:27:00 · 262 阅读 · 0 评论 -
29-jsp中用js进行时间格式转化
CST可以为如下4个不同的时区的缩写: 美国中部时间:Central Standard Time (USA) UT-6:00 澳大利亚中部时间:Central Standard Time (Australia) UT+9:30 中国标准时间:China Standard Time UT+8:00 古巴标准时间:Cuba Standard Time UT-4:00GMT 世...原创 2019-01-11 10:14:00 · 132 阅读 · 0 评论 -
14-Navicat 连接远程服务器mysql 出错:1130-host . is not allowed to connect to this MySql server,MySQL...
解决Navicat 出错:1130-host . is not allowed to connect to this MySql server,MySQL1. 改表法。可能是你的帐号不允许从远程登陆,只能在localhost。这个时候只要在localhost的那台电脑,登入MySQL后,更改 "mysql" 数据库里的 "user" 表里的 "host" 项,从"localhost"改称"...原创 2019-05-14 21:34:00 · 73 阅读 · 0 评论 -
54-jquery发送请求 json 转化等
直接记录代码吧。几个注意点:1.回调函数:function就是 success(data, textStatus, jqXHR)。这三个参数的分别意义是:服务端送回来的数据,服务端的返回码,XMLHTTPRequest的一个超集2. 如果是数组参数:例如d[this.name] = this.value;传到后端想要成为json 需要转化:data: JSON.strin...原创 2019-06-29 19:34:00 · 78 阅读 · 0 评论 -
55-mybatis dao 和 映射xml
注意点:1.nested exception is org.apache.ibatis.binding.BindingException: Parameter 'record_id' not found. Ava错误原因:①可能是参数没有定义参数名,对应不上,可以如下:public void deleteQues(@Param("id") String id);②如果是对象则不...原创 2019-06-30 14:30:00 · 157 阅读 · 0 评论 -
56-MyBatis关联映射之一对多映射
转载自:MyBatis学习(六)MyBatis关联映射之一对多映射他写的真详细!!!数据库中一对多通常使用主外键关联,外键应该在多方,即多方维护关系。补充:如果映射时存在多个参数时:<collection property="answers" column="id=id,userid=userId" fetchType="lazy"javaType="ArrayLis...原创 2019-07-01 01:01:00 · 100 阅读 · 0 评论 -
57-java 开发环境配置,mysql解压版安装
java环境变量配置: https://blog.csdn.net/qq_41436122/article/details/82620080mysql 5.7.21 解压版安装配置方法图文教程: https://www.jb51.net/article/140951.htm原创 2019-07-02 17:06:00 · 129 阅读 · 0 评论 -
58-转载:Java遍历List四种方法的效率对比
转载自:Java遍历List四种方法的效率对比感觉这篇文章总结的很好,从底层原理讲的。懒得总结了,直接搬来了。建议直接看原文!!!总结(1)对于ArrayList和LinkedList,在size小于1000时,每种方式的差距都在几ms之间,差别不大,选择哪个方式都可以。(2)对于ArrayList,无论size是多大,差距都不大,选择哪个方式都可以。(3)对于LinkedL...原创 2019-07-02 22:55:00 · 94 阅读 · 0 评论